The 16th century Carmelite nun St. Teresa, surrounded by candles and crosses, fantasizes about making love to a crucified Christ and her own psyche.
2004
2025
2014
1976
2006
2013
2012
1980
1988
1982
1977
2011
2010
2008
2003
2022